![]() ![]() When your Venus falls into another person's fourth house, the other person usually feels very comfortable and "at home" with you. The fourth house is ruled by Cancer/the Moon (which is a Water sign/planet) and thus it is an emotionally vulnerable house because it rules motherhood and the family of origin. When your Venus and your Pluto fall into your partner's fourth house, this will usually have a powerful effect on your partner's emotions - one which is not always comfortable, since Pluto tends to transform whatever it touches. How this attraction plays out between you will be affected to some extent by the aspects your Mars forms with other planets in your partner's chart and your own, what sign your Mars is in, and what sign/planet is the fifth house ruler in your partner's chart. Among other things, the fifth house rules romance and children - so when your Mars falls into your partner's fifth house, it tends to generate sexual interest (although not necessarily of the kind which leads to long-term commitment). In the natal chart, Mars is considered to be the planet which rules sexuality even though the eighth house in the chart (ruled by Scorpio/Pluto) is considered to be the house of sex. ![]() ![]() When your Mars is in your partner's fifth house, this is usually an indication of strong sexual chemistry. ![]()
